Job Description

TITLE: CUSTODIAL & BUILDING MAINTENANCE WORKER

DEPARTMENT: Facilities

JOB CODE: CBMW

DATE: 10/01/2025 (rev)

REPORTS TO: Facilities Manager

DLSE STATUS: Non-Exempt

Under supervision of the Facilities Manager performs a variety of custodial and maintenance duties to maintain the condition and appearance of university buildings and facilities in accordance with established standards. Must be able to work any shift.

Sweeps mops polishes and buffs floors using power cleaning equipment. Vacuums and spot clean carpets.

Performs general custodial duties in an office such as cleaning dusting washing windows and moving and polishing furniture and equipment.

Cleans fixtures equipment windows walls restrooms etc. Stock supplies in restrooms as scheduled and as needed.

Picks up trash and litter; removes and replace trash bags from containers.

Cleans elevators and stairwell areas.

Mixes chemicals for performing custodial tasks using appropriate procedures.

Sweeps walkways and staircases.

Assists in assuring that service requests are completed accurately and in a timely manner.

Maintains all the Universitys indoor plants in an attractive and healthy condition.

Performs specialty tasks as assigned by the Supervisor for building maintenance and custodial services.

Oversee or perform complex or difficult maintenance repairs or installations.

Work from blueprints and drawings in constructing and repairing woodwork such as counters benches stairs doors floors and windows.

Read blueprints work from sketches or verbal instructions to locate rooms vents pipes etc.

Replace faulty switches sockets outlets bulbs fixtures fluorescent lights starters etc. and other simple elements of electrical systems.

Install maintain and repair sinks showers toilets water heaters and plumbing fixtures such as washers faucets broken pipes and snakes drains.

Dismantle electrical machinery and replace defective electrical or mechanical parts such as gears brushes and armatures.

Repair or replace windows doors ceiling and floor tile plus various wooden wall coverings. Repair furniture such as cabinets chairs stores fixtures and office equipment. Repair loose or broken joints.

Paint varnish stain enamel lacquer and redecorate walls woodwork and fixtures of buildings and facilities using appropriate tools and techniques.

Mixes and applies paints and other finishing coats to interior and exterior surfaces by means of brush spray gun or roller.

Drive university trucks operates forklift cherry picker outdoor steam machine various compressors and jackhammer.

Work with plaster and brick to repair and maintain buildings and facilities.

Maintain and repair custodial and building maintenance electrical equipment.

Uses hand tools power tools and testing instruments for repairs and maintenance of machinery and equipment.

Assist with campus moves and special events including setting-up stages canopies public address systems etc.

Assist with moving furniture and equipment.

Other duties as requested.

High School Diploma or Equivalency.

Vocational/Specialized Training beyond high school is a plus.

Valid California Drivers license.

2-3 years experience in custodial general maintenance and repairs.

Knowledge of all the basics of cleaning and general maintenance practices.

Journeyman level knowledge in general maintenance.

Ability to operate power cleaning equipment.

Good written oral and interpersonal skills.

Ability to read label instructions to mix chemicals.

Ability to read blueprints and sketches

Ability to lift up to 50lbs.

Ability to bend stoop climb push etc.

Must maintain a good driving record and meet the universitys requirements for insurability.

Must pass annual physical including DOT.
